Schiller Park's St. Beatrice is a private school. It is coed and Roman Catholic affiliated, serving 134 students in grades PK-8.

St. Beatrice is a family-oriented school. Class sizes are relatively small, giving a lot of care and attention to each child. The faculty is hard-working and very dedicated, with a tremendous amount of education and experience. The children are challenged to live and grow in their faith each day.We attend and participate in Mass every Friday. The parish is very supportive of the school, too. It is clear that the children are receiving a great education based on the results of their standardized test scoes each year, and advanced placements in high school. Lots of fun extra-curricular activities are available, as well, such as: Basketball, Cheerleading, Chess Club, Choir, Drama, Volleyball and more!
